CSHCN Children with Special Health Care Needs       

Assisting parents that have children with special needs to access the care they need..

Through home or office visits, a public health nurse assists parents that have children with special needs, birth to 18 years old, access health care and any other support services the family may need. For more information please visit the following sites:

     Safe and Healthy Kids in Child Care  Call 886-6400, ext 425

This resource for public health, safety and child development information is available for child care providers in licensed homes and centers, through site visits or phone consultations.

Goals:

* Decrease the incidence of communicable disease and injuries in child care.

* Increase the providers understanding of all stages of child development.

* Giving child care providers resources that will benefit providers, children and parents.
